Chamuska backs Al Nassr for the Saudi Pro League title

Brazilian coach Péricles Chamuska of Taawon spoke about many aspects of the Saudi Pro League this season, amid a strong revival his side is enjoying.

Taawon secured their fifth consecutive away win, beating Al-Kholood 2-0, reaching 25 points in third place and keeping pace with the top teams.

Chamuska told AFP that the decision to raise the number of foreign players to eight has negatively affected Saudi talent.

The Brazilian coach agreed with his French counterpart Hervé Renard, the Saudi national team coach, that the matter must be balanced so as not to affect the Green.

Chamuska said he is proud to be considered for the Saudi national team job and regards Renard as the most suitable for the next phase.

He also spoke highly of Saudi football, noting that it has evolved greatly and the quality has risen, placing the Saudi league among the world’s top leagues.

Nassr are currently the title frontrunners, and Chamuska acknowledged that the club’s strong position elevates expectations across the league.

The coach believes Nassr, sitting at the summit with 30 points, is the main favorite to clinch the trophy, and that the current squad is the best Nassr has had in eight years.

He also noted that Al-Hilal hasn’t started this season as well as hoped, and with adjustments to align with Italian coach Simone Inzaghi, the team will be a serious contender in the title race.

Chamuska also praised Ronaldo, confirming that the Portuguese star remains a model of professionalism and dedication, living a perfect feeding and sleep routine, and possessing a mindset that helps him stay at the top.
